Hello there,

I am looking for a tool which would help me to split files according to word count. Lets say I have a huge sdl xliff file which should be split in several parts - first part consists of 1000 words, second - 3000 words and third - 5000 words. I have used "SDL XLIFF Split and Merge" so far but it divides files only in similar parts.

Can you recommend any tools or methods?

Thanks in advance!
